| Area | Trend Focus |
|---|---|
| Shower Areas | Walk-in showers with glass enclosures and multiple jets |
| Vanities | Floating designs with integrated lighting |
| Color Schemes | Neutral tones accented with bold colors |
| Lighting | Layered LED lighting for ambiance |
| Materials | Porcelain, natural stone, textured surfaces |
| Fixtures | Wall-mounted faucets and sleek hardware |
| Technology | Touchless fixtures and digital controls |
| Storage | Built-in shelves and minimalist cabinets |
